The Versatility and Applications of Plastic Netting Mesh
Plastic netting mesh is a versatile material that has gained significant popularity in various industries due to its numerous beneficial properties. Made from high-density polyethylene (HDPE), polypropylene, or other synthetic materials, plastic netting mesh is known for its durability, lightweight characteristics, and resistance to environmental factors such as moisture, chemicals, and UV rays. This article explores the various applications and advantages of plastic netting mesh, highlighting its importance in agriculture, construction, and other sectors.
Agricultural Applications
One of the most prominent uses of plastic netting mesh is in the agriculture sector. Farmers utilize this material for crop protection, weed control, and pest management. The mesh provides a physical barrier that prevents larger pests from reaching plants while allowing sunlight, air, and rain to nourish the crops.
For instance, plastic netting is frequently used in the cultivation of fruits, vegetables, and flowers. When draped over young plants, it not only shields them from pests but also mitigates the risk of disease by promoting better air circulation around the plants. Additionally, specialized netting can offer protection against birds and other animals that may be inclined to eat the crops. The lightweight nature of plastic netting makes it easy to handle, install, and remove when necessary.
Garden Fencing and Support
Home gardeners and landscapers also benefit from plastic netting mesh. It can be employed as a lightweight fencing solution to keep pets and small animals from damaging gardens. Besides, gardeners can use plastic trellis netting to support climbing plants, such as peas, cucumbers, and tomatoes, facilitating vertical growth that can save space and prevent ground decay.
Furthermore, this type of netting is often used to create protective barriers around newly planted trees or shrubs to safeguard them from browsing wildlife, creating a safe environment for proper growth and development.
Construction and Industrial Uses
In addition to its agricultural benefits, plastic netting mesh has extensive applications in the construction and industrial sectors. Builders use this material for scaffolding and debris containment to ensure safety on construction sites. The use of plastic netting can significantly reduce the incidence of accidents caused by falling debris, thereby enhancing workplace safety.
Moreover, construction workers often rely on plastic mesh for erosion control. When installed on slopes and embankments, it provides stability and prevents soil erosion caused by wind and water runoff. This application is particularly important in landscaping and civil engineering projects, where maintaining the integrity of the soil is vital.
Environmental and Recycling Considerations
As environmental awareness grows, many manufacturers are starting to produce plastic netting mesh from recycled materials, making it a more sustainable choice. The recycling potential of plastic netting not only reduces plastic waste but also lowers the demand for virgin materials, which can be beneficial for the environment.
Additionally, the durability of plastic netting mesh contributes to its longevity, meaning that it does not need to be replaced as often as other products. This characteristic reduces the overall consumption of materials and fosters a more sustainable approach to agricultural and industrial practices.
